Android O could be released as soon as the week of August 21, "most likely on the 21st itself," prolific gadgets leaker Evan Blass tweeted on Monday.
Android O will be the eighth generation of the Android operating system, and it'll be an incremental update with performance, feature, and design improvements rather than a major overhaul.
It's likely that Google's own Pixel smartphones will be the first recipients of Android O if it is actually released on August 21. Indeed, Google's own devices usually get the updates first, and third-party phones get them much later.
